Construction Drawings

After you have given the approval on your design, I proceed with the construction/permit drawings. Your drawing package will include all the drawings and information required for obtaining a permit and building your house, such as floor plans, elevations, sections, site plan etc. During this step I work with the structural engineer you have selected and ensure they will approve the proposed structure of the home.
